The Breakdown 14

  • The fashion world gathered in Milan to celebrate the unveiling of Giorgio Armani's final collection, a poignant tribute to the legendary designer who passed away on September 4, 2025, at the age of 91.
  • This event marked not only the conclusion of Armani’s illustrious career but also the 50th anniversary of his iconic fashion line, making it a deeply significant moment in the industry.
  • The runway show held at the Brera Art Gallery was graced by Hollywood stars, including Cate Blanchett, Glenn Close, and Richard Gere, who honored Armani's legacy with their presence.
  • Attendees experienced a beautifully curated collection that embodied Armani's signature style—an enchanting blend of elegance and quiet luxury, resonating with both nostalgia and innovation.
  • The atmosphere was a mix of celebration and solemn reflection, capturing the essence of Armani's influence on fashion while serving as a fitting memorial to his remarkable life and work.
  • Media reviews highlighted the emotional depth of the collection, emphasizing how it encapsulated Armani's design philosophy, leaving an indelible mark on the fashion landscape long after his passing.

What impact did Armani have on fashion?

Giorgio Armani revolutionized fashion by introducing a relaxed elegance that contrasted sharply with the more structured styles of the 1980s. His designs emphasized comfort without sacrificing sophistication, making them popular among both men and women. Armani is credited with popularizing the 'power suit' for women, which became a symbol of female empowerment in the workplace. His influence extends beyond clothing to include fragrances and accessories, establishing a lifestyle brand that reflects luxury and timelessness.

How did Armani's designs evolve over time?

Armani's designs evolved from the bold, structured silhouettes of the 1980s to a more fluid and relaxed aesthetic in later years. Initially known for his tailored suits, he gradually embraced softer fabrics and more casual styles, reflecting changing societal norms and consumer preferences. His final collection showcased this evolution, combining classic Armani elements with contemporary interpretations, emphasizing a quiet luxury that resonated with both traditional and modern audiences.

What are some of Armani's most iconic designs?

Some of Giorgio Armani's most iconic designs include the unstructured jacket, the power suit for women, and his signature evening gowns. The unstructured jacket, which allowed for greater movement and comfort, became a staple in both men's and women's wardrobes. His power suits, characterized by sharp tailoring and elegant lines, symbolized women's empowerment in the workplace during the 1980s. Additionally, his luxurious evening gowns, often adorned with exquisite fabrics, have graced numerous red carpets and high-profile events.

How does Armani's legacy compare to other designers?

Armani's legacy is distinguished by his pioneering approach to luxury and ready-to-wear fashion, setting him apart from contemporaries like Chanel and Versace. While Chanel is known for its timeless elegance and Versace for bold, provocative designs, Armani's emphasis on understated sophistication and comfort transformed modern fashion. His influence on the 'power suit' and contributions to both men’s and women’s fashion have left an indelible mark, positioning him as a transformative figure whose work continues to inspire future generations.
